WebMaternal haplogroups that indicate Native American heritage are A, B, C, D, and X. You can determine the base haplogroup through any mtDNA test at Family Tree DNA. To determine the complete haplogroup designation you need their full mitochondrial sequence test. You think you’re part Native American but can’t identify a specific ancestor Web1. WebNative American tribal members are citizens of their nations. This is a political and cultural identification rather than a genetic identification, similar to being a citizen of any other … http://www.gocollege.com/financial-aid/college-grants/native-american.html
